Sorts Of Paint Finishes



When it involves repaint finishes, there are 5 main types you ought to understand about: flat, eggshell, satin, semi-gloss, and gloss. Each type offers a certain function and can dramatically influence the appearance of your area.

Flat surfaces have a matte look, making them wonderful for hiding imperfections on wall surfaces. They're excellent for ceilings or low-traffic areas but can be challenging to clean.

Eggshell finishes provide a mild sheen, providing more resilience while still being forgiving on flaws. They're optimal for living spaces or rooms.

Satin finishes are prominent for their soft luster, making them flexible for various applications, including kitchens and bathrooms. They're easier to clean than flat or eggshell surfaces, making them practical for high-traffic locations.

Selecting the Right End Up



Choosing the ideal paint surface can be a video game changer in your home's visual and functionality. To make the most effective selection, think about the area's objective and the level of sturdiness you require.

For high-traffic locations like corridors or kitchens, opt for a satin or semi-gloss finish; these are extra resistant to stains and easy to tidy.

If you're repainting a bedroom or a living room, a flat or eggshell finish could be the method to go. These surfaces offer a softer appearance and can conceal blemishes well, producing a comfortable atmosphere.

Do not forget lights, either. Shiny coatings can show light, making a tiny space feel bigger, while matte finishes take in light, adding heat.

Lastly, think about upkeep. Glossy coatings need more normal maintenance to maintain their sparkle, while matte coatings may need touch-ups more frequently because of scuffs.
